The Ultrafine Screen Market size was valued at USD 1.5 Billion in 2022 and is projected to reach USD 2.8 Billion by 2030, growing at a CAGR of 8.6% from 2024 to 2030.
The Ultrafine Screen Market is primarily driven by its diverse applications across various industries, with notable use in water treatment and the mining industry. These applications are crucial in offering highly effective separation solutions, enabling industries to achieve higher efficiencies and meet stringent regulatory standards. The ultrafine screen technology allows for the filtration of particles at an exceptionally small size, making it ideal for applications requiring precise separation of contaminants or valuable materials. Additionally, the increasing demand for cleaner and more sustainable processes across industries further boosts the market growth.
Among the major applications, the water treatment segment holds a significant share in the ultrafine screen market. As concerns about water pollution and resource conservation grow, the need for advanced water treatment solutions continues to rise. Ultrafine screens are utilized in municipal wastewater treatment plants, industrial effluent processing, and desalination processes, enabling the filtration of suspended solids, organic materials, and even fine particulate matter. With ongoing water scarcity challenges and rising environmental awareness, the ultrafine screen technology provides an essential solution for maintaining clean and safe water sources.

The mining industry, known for its complex and often harsh operational environments, heavily relies on efficient separation technologies such as ultrafine screens. These screens are essential in extracting valuable minerals and metals from ore by separating finer particles, which enhances recovery rates and reduces processing time. In mining operations, ultrafine screens are employed to separate fine-grained materials from slurry, aiding in the efficient extraction of desired resources. The growing demand for high-quality mineral products across various industries, including electronics and automotive, continues to drive the adoption of ultrafine screens within the mining sector.
Additionally, the mining industry is increasingly focused on improving sustainability, and ultrafine screens offer a solution for reducing the environmental impact of mining activities. These screens facilitate the efficient reuse of water, decrease the need for harmful chemicals, and minimize waste generation, thus promoting environmentally friendly mining practices. The "Other" subsegment of the ultrafine screen market covers a range of diverse applications beyond water treatment and mining. This includes industries such as pharmaceuticals, food processing, oil and gas, and chemicals, where ultrafine screens are used to filter and separate fine materials, improve product quality, and enhance operational efficiency. In these sectors, ultrafine screens ensure that only the desired particle size reaches the final product, thus ensuring high standards of purity, consistency, and safety. What are ultrafine screens used for in the water treatment industry?
Ultrafine screens are used in water treatment to filter fine particles, pollutants, and contaminants, improving water quality for safe consumption.
How do ultrafine screens benefit the mining industry?
In mining, ultrafine screens are used to separate fine materials from slurry, improving resource recovery and reducing operational costs.
What are the main advantages of ultrafine screens over traditional filtration methods?
Ultrafine screens offer superior filtration efficiency, reduce waste, and require less maintenance compared to conventional filtration systems.
What industries use ultrafine screens besides water treatment and mining?
Ultrafine screens are used in industries such as pharmaceuticals, food processing, chemicals, and oil and gas for precise separation and filtration.
Are ultrafine screens environmentally friendly?
Yes, ultrafine screens promote sustainability by reducing energy consumption, water wastage, and the need for harmful chemicals in industrial processes.
